IV Lluis Fisas i Moreno Drawing and Painting Competition
From the Molins de Rei Artistic Circle and the Children's Department of the Molins de Rei City Council we present the rules for the XIII Lluís Fisas i Moreno Drawing and Painting Competition.
As every year, on the occasion of the town's Festa Major, the Lluís Fisas i Moreno drawing contest is organized in which all children and young people aged 6 to 18 can participate.
The theme for this edition is the Molins de Rei Horror Film Festival. There are 3 categories: Children (6 to 9 years old), Teenagers (10 to 14 years old) and Youth (15 to 18 years old).
The submitted works will be exhibited from November 7 to 18, 2019 on the Workers' Federation Boulevard.
